Hobolans (Western Slavs), Przybysław Henry (1127-50), Denar - prince on horseback

Reference: Kałkowski str. 76, Bahrfeld (Brandenburg) 1b

A very rare issue of the last of the rulers of the Hobolan tribe - the geographically westernmost Slavs. Widely described in the pages of the classic -"A Thousand Years of Polish Coinage". - by which it is also present in distinguished Polish collections (e.g. Karolkiewicz).

Obverse: a prince on horseback, with a flag, behind him a cross. In the rim the inscription [HEINRICVS].

Reverse: a three-towered building (believed to be a church in the town of Brenna). In the rim the inscription.

Silver, diameter 22 mm, weight 0.78 g.
